Since I've been quite busy at work, with long hours, I've kept pretty much to by standard vegan diet for both of the past two days. The cereal/banana/OJ breakfast, snacks of nuts and an apple during the work day, followed by a dinner salad with spinich, kale, tomatoes, carrots, hummus, and walnuts. I did try a packaged product for dinner yesterday, Road's End Organics Mac & Chreese. Maybe I cooked it wrong, but it tasted like cardboard (at least what I imagine cardboard to taste like). Not recommended if you're looking for a classic macaroni and cheese alternative. I tried adding some flavor by adding Earth Balance buttery spread and some almond milk, which only helped a little. Perhaps their cheddar style is better.
